3 Characters That Give Dentists a Bad Reputation

There is an incredible number of people who are afraid of the dentist. Many of them have had a bad experience, but oftentimes their fear comes from something they’ve seen in the media.

For sure, dentists have had some pretty poor representatives in pop culture. Here are some of the most prominent examples, and why your dentist won’t make you feel the same way.

Steve Martin in Little Shop of Horrors

Starting with one of the most iconic dentists in pop culture, there’s Steve Martins’ famous portrayal of Orin Scrivello in the movie musical Little Shop of Horrors. In this movie, Orin is a dentist, nitrous oxide addict, and abusive boyfriend of the story’s main love interest. In his dedicated musical number, he proclaims proudly that he has a “talent for causing things pain.” Ultimately, it’s hard to think of a dentist you’d rather see fed to a plant.

Sir Laurence Olivier in Marathon Man

In this iconic 70s thriller, Dustin Hoffman is on the run from a Nazi dentist, portrayed by Sir Laurence Olivier. In what’s unfortunately one of the most iconic dentistry scenes in the history of film, the dentist uses his knowledge of dentistry to torture Hoffman, alternating between the dental drill and numbing clove oil. Obviously, your actual dentist’s priority is to keep you comfortable. That said, after viewing this scene… maybe you’ll show them a little more respect.

The Carol Burnett Show’s Dentist Sketch

Another classic of the 70s, one of The Carol Burnett Show’s most famous sketches revolves around a new dentist, played by Tim Conway, treating a patient’s toothache. After quite a few mishaps, the dentist uses Novocain to numb his own hand, leg, and face, before accidentally knocking the patient’s tooth out with the dental light.

Of course, these pop culture dentists aren’t representative of the real world. Actual dentists aren’t as sadistic as Sir Laurence Olivier or as clumsy as Tim Conway—they’re normal people who will work hard to give you the smile you deserve! And unlike Steve Martin, they’ll use nitrous oxide to put you at ease, not on themselves.
